How they compare
Côte d'Ivoire currently reports 146 against 146 in Syria, a difference of 0.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 11 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Syria ahead.
Côte d'Ivoire ranks 66th and Syria ranks 66th of 144 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Côte d'Ivoire averaged higher in 1 and Syria in 4.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Côte d'Ivoire | Syria |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 24.5 | 36 | 11.5 | Syria |
| 1970s | 36.5 | 44 | 7.5 | Syria |
| 1980s | 54.5 | 59.5 | 5 | Syria |
| 1990s | 82 | 85.5 | 3.5 | Syria |
| 2000s | 118 | 117.5 | 0.5 | Côte d'Ivoire |
| 2010s | 146 | 146 | 0 | — |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
